About Area Code 346
Area code 346 serves the Houston metropolitan area in southeast Texas, including communities around Houston and across the region’s expanding suburban belt. The area follows Central Time, as does most of Texas.

Area Code 346 History and Coverage
Area code 346 was introduced in 2014 as an overlay on the existing 713, 281, and 832 numbering plan area. The introduction of this new code showed that there was still high demand for telephone numbers in the region defined by growth of the population, suburban developments, and numerous employers. The older 713 code was implemented in 1947, when it covered a far wider swath of southeast Texas. A 1996 split yielded the 281 code, and the 832 code was introduced as an overlay; 346 is another code used in this interconnected numbering plan area.
Instead of defining a new territory, the code 346 is used in the entire shared service area. This area spans most of Harris County and extends into neighboring sections of Fort Bend and Montgomery counties, as development occurs in this part of the Gulf Coastal Plain. Growth in population and employment has occurred along the roads that lead to Sugar Land, The Woodlands, and other peripheral areas. The economy of the region involves energy, healthcare, logistics, manufacturing, and higher education industries, providing demand for more numbers. The Galveston Bay and Upper Texas Coast make up the southern part of the broader metropolitan area.
